Taylor Schuster Recognized by the Business and Economics Department at Wheaton College (Ill.)

2016 Jul 1

Wheaton College student Taylor Schuster of Fond du Lac, Wisconsin was recently recognized with the C. William Pollard Award for Business and the Liberal Arts. This award was presented by the Business and Economics Department at Wheaton College's Honors Convocation.

The C. William Pollard Award for Business and the Liberal Arts is awarded to a senior who is a major in the Business and Economics Department. The recipient is selected by the department faculty and honors a student who exhibits outstanding future potential for leadership in the world of business by exemplifying during his or her studies at Wheaton College Christian maturity, academic excellence, enthusiasm for and potential for success in business, and the liberal arts ideal of breadth and depth of perspective.
